Media Reviews
Robert Parker
I don’t believe I have ever tasted a better d’Angludet than this 2005. It reveals an inky/black/purple hue as well as an explosive bouquet of road tar, blackberries, cassis, underbrush, and forest floor characteristics. Medium to full-bodied with sweet tannin, copious glycerin, and a heady finish, it is a sumptuous, atypically forward 2005 to consume during its first 12-15 years of life. 90-92 points
